The U.S. Post Office-Helper Main at 45 S. Main in Helper, Utah was built in 1938. It has also been known as Helper Main Post Office. It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1989.[1] The post office is located in the Helper Commercial District.
It includes a mural by artist Jenne Magafan.[2]
